Efficient QA testing demands seamless communication and swift collaboration. Integrating Slack with QA testing workflows transforms manual, time-intensive processes into streamlined, automated solutions that keep teams aligned. This article breaks down how to set up a QA Testing Slack Workflow Integration, why it’s essential, and the actionable steps to make it a reality.
Why Integrate Slack with QA Testing Workflows?
Slack is a powerful tool for real-time communication, and connecting it with your QA processes adds an extra layer of efficiency. A QA Slack Workflow Integration allows you to:
- Get Instant Notifications: Automatic updates for test executions, failed test cases, or bug assignments ensure your team stays informed without endless email threads.
- Enhance Collaboration: Team members can discuss bugs, fixes, or test strategies in dedicated Slack channels, reducing response times.
- Automate Status Reports: Summarized test results can be sent to Slack channels, offering transparency without manual effort.
- Boost Accountability: Tagging individuals or teams ensures tasks are owned and resolved promptly.
Key Features of an Effective QA Testing Slack Integration
To achieve the maximum benefit, your integration should include the following core components:
- Event-Based Notifications: Automatically send Slack updates when specific events occur, like failed tests, merged pull requests, or reopened bugs.
- Customizable Alerts: Enable teams to configure notification preferences to avoid noise and focus on critical updates.
- Interactive Commands: Use Slack commands to trigger test executions or retrieve reports directly from the chat interface.
- CI/CD Integration: Seamlessly pull testing insights from your Continuous Integration/Continuous Deployment workflows into Slack.
How to Set Up QA Testing Slack Workflow Integration
Setting up this integration doesn’t have to be complicated. Follow these steps to align Slack with your QA processes effectively:
1. Define Objectives and Use Cases
Before integrating, identify what your team needs from the connection. Examples include alerts for test runs, summaries of failed tests, or reminders about blocked tickets.
2. Choose the Right Tools
Select a tool or platform, like Hoop.dev, that simplifies building Slack integrations for QA workflows. Focus on platforms designed to work effortlessly with your testing tools and CI/CD pipelines.
3. Configure Notifications
Set up Slack channels for key testing updates. Example configurations: